Responsibilities
Under the supervision of a highly-qualified BCBA, the BCaBA will:
Design and oversee individualized ABA programs based on assessments.
Conduct skills and behavior assessments (FBAs, preference assessments, etc.).
Train and supervise Registered Behavior Technicians (RBTs) to ensure effective implementation.
Provide parent training and occasional direct therapy as needed.
Analyze data to monitor progress and adjust interventions.
Collaborate with families and interdisciplinary teams.
Maintain accurate documentation while ensuring compliance with ethical and legal standards.
Stay updated on best practices in behavior analysis.
